JWindow y JDialog
Tengo un problema de ventanas. Tengo una VentanaLogin que hereda de JDialog y VentanaLogin crea una VentanaSplash que hereda de JWindow. El problema es que cuando se llama a setVisible(true) en VentanaSplash aparece en blanco, no se dibujan bien los componentes. No sé si es porque ambas clases heredan de componentes de alto nivel y hay algún tipo de conflicto o qué puede ser.
Si alguien puede ayudarme, por favor, se lo agradecerÃa eternamente.
Si alguien puede ayudarme, por favor, se lo agradecerÃa eternamente.
Prueba con esto:
JLabel uno= new JLabel("Primer termino");
setLayout(null);
add(uno);
uno.setBounds(12,50,100,25);
donde el conponente que lo agraga es la funcion
setBounds(posicionx, posiciony, ancho, alto);
Espero que te sirva.
Bye
JLabel uno= new JLabel("Primer termino");
setLayout(null);
add(uno);
uno.setBounds(12,50,100,25);
donde el conponente que lo agraga es la funcion
setBounds(posicionx, posiciony, ancho, alto);
Espero que te sirva.
Bye
Gracias por tu contestación, Breckver; aunque parecÃa que iba a funcionar tu solución, al final no lo hizo. Parece ser que cuando se ejecuta el código que está en el oyente, la parte gráfica no se dibuja y ese es precisamente el problema, que cuando se pulsa el botón aceptar se tienen que cargar unas tablas y como eso tarda bastante necesito que salga una pantalla de carga. Estoy intentando sacar fuera del oyente todo el código que no es demasiado necesario que esté ahà y cargar las tablas justo después... De todas formas, muchas gracias por tu ayuda.
